Local ISPs behind Emure-Ekiti proxies
The residential IPs you'll use in Emure-Ekiti trace back to Nigeria broadband and mobile carriers such as MTN, Airtel, Glo and 9mobile. Because these are the same networks real residents browse on, sites see nothing unusual about your traffic. When you evaluate a provider, a larger, more diverse Nigeria pool spanning multiple ISPs means fewer overused IPs and higher success rates in Emure-Ekiti.
Setting up Emure-Ekiti residential proxies
After signing up, you'll receive a proxy host, port and credentials. Most providers let you geo-target by country and, on many networks, by city — so you can request IPs specifically from Emure-Ekiti, Nigeria. Configure your tool with those endpoint details, choose rotating or sticky mode, and you're live. Start with a small request rate, confirm your exit IP resolves to Nigeria, then scale up as needed.

Are free Emure-Ekiti proxies safe?
Free proxy lists are risky: they're slow, unreliable, often already blocked, and some intercept your traffic. For anything involving Nigeria business data or accounts, use a paid, ethically sourced residential provider from the comparison above instead.
How do I verify my proxy is really in Emure-Ekiti?
After connecting, check your exit IP with an IP geolocation lookup — it should resolve to Nigeria and, ideally, the Emure-Ekiti area, on a residential ISP such as MTN. Note that geolocation is approximate, so IPs may map to nearby parts of Ekiti State, Nigeria.
